Chitty Chitty bang bang 454 4-speed in an 81 Trans AM is back at $1300 NR. Description seems honest to me FWIW. The car sold last time for just over $2K. Sometimes (not for this car) the buyer flakes and the car is relisted, with the new ad raging on the non-paying buyer (fair enough). If I was interested I'd ping the seller and find out. Anyway, the frame is not so bad, and this is a Trans AM, with a 4-speed and posi rear. Comes with a BOS sale only, but 454's aren't laying around junkyards anymore and is probably worth selling for some decent cash. It's a good parts car, and if it turned out to be a WS6, those suspension parts aren't laying around in junkyards either.

66 Lemans convertible in Tennessee with an LS2 at $55K. I think a lot of people think putting an LS engine in an old Pontiac makes it worth $50K. This is a nice car, but it's overpriced IMO compared to what you can get for $55K. In theory, you're changing the engine, gauges, etc., so it shouldn't really matter that this started life as a Lemans, but it does matter when you're asking for that much money. $55K cars don't typically have a home made speaker box sitting in the back seat. I dislike the halo headlights. They aren't go-faster things, but new technology things. I guess my tastes are just stuck in the past. I like old Pontiacs to look like old Pontiacs.
